Cairo and the World

A city of more than 20 million people generates a calling pattern no single description can capture. In Mohandessin and Dokki, engineers and architects with relatives working Gulf contracts call Saudi Arabia and the UAE multiple times a week. In Ain Shams and Shubra, families whose sons and daughters took the Italy or France route keep irregular but emotionally loaded transatlantic calls going. In Heliopolis, a business call to Dubai or London might be billed to a corporate account; in Imbaba, the same call comes out of personal credit. Egyptian carriers — Orange Egypt, Vodafone Egypt and Etisalat (now e&) — operate in a market where the gap between what international calling should cost and what it actually costs has been a pressure point for decades. IDD rates from Egyptian SIMs to Gulf numbers aren't uniformly cheap, and calling European mobile numbers from Egypt can be expensive enough that the call gets deferred. Cairo's massive population, spread across income levels that vary enormously by district, means that international calling on standard carrier rates is a burden felt keenly in some neighborhoods and barely at all in others.

Who Calls Abroad from Cairo

Cairo itself is the origin point for Egypt's emigration corridors rather than the destination for foreign diaspora communities. The Gulf — Saudi Arabia, the UAE, Kuwait, Qatar — absorbs the largest share of Egyptian workers, a pattern that has defined Cairo family life since the oil boom of the 1970s. Italy has a significant Egyptian community, particularly from Upper Egyptian families who settled in Milan and Turin and continue calling home to relatives who remained in Cairo. The US holds a substantial Egyptian-American professional community. Greeks, Armenians and Levantine Arab communities that once defined Cairo's cosmopolitan quarter have largely emigrated, but descendants sometimes call back. Sudanese and Libyan refugees, present in significant numbers, maintain their own active corridors southward and westward.

Telecommunications in Taiwan

Taiwan boasts a robust telecommunications infrastructure characterized by a high rate of mobile phone penetration and advanced network coverage. The three main mobile network operators are Chunghwa Telecom, Taiwan Mobile, and FarEasTone. These providers offer extensive 4G and emerging 5G services, ensuring that urban and rural areas alike have reliable mobile connectivity. As of 2023, Taiwan's 5G network covers approximately 80% of the population, with continuous expansion planned. Landline availability remains significant, especially in urban areas, as many households still utilize traditional phone services. Mobile phone usage is widespread, with an estimated mobile penetration rate exceeding 130%, indicating that many residents own multiple devices. The Taiwanese government has also promoted digitalization, leading to a surge in mobile applications for communication, such as LINE, which is particularly popular for both personal and business interactions. Overall, Taiwan's telecommunications landscape is modern, efficient, and integral to daily life.

Dialing Taiwan from Abroad

To make an international phone call to Taiwan, follow these steps: 1. **Dial the exit code**: Depending on your country, this is typically "00" (Europe) or "011" (North America). 2. **Dial the country code for Taiwan**: This is "886". 3. **Dial the area code**: Taiwan has a variety of area codes, typically ranging from 2 to 3 digits. For example, Taipei's area code is "2". 4. **Dial the local number**: The local number is usually 7 to 8 digits long. When calling a mobile phone in Taiwan, you do not need to dial the area code. Instead, simply start with the mobile number, which usually begins with a "9" or "8". If you're calling a landline, ensure to include the area code. No special prefixes are required beyond the country code and area code. For example, to call a Taipei landline number like 1234-5678 from the US, you would dial 011-886-2-1234-5678.

Calling Etiquette in Taiwan

Phone call etiquette in Taiwan is shaped by a blend of traditional values and modern practices. When answering calls, individuals typically greet the caller with a simple "Hello" or a more formal "您好" (nǐ hǎo) in Mandarin, which translates to "you good." For informal settings, friends may use first names or nicknames, while in business contexts, titles and surnames are preferred. Cold calling is generally acceptable in certain contexts, especially in business environments, but it is advisable to introduce yourself and your purpose clearly. Personal calls often involve a brief exchange of pleasantries before addressing the main topic. In business communications, it is common to schedule calls in advance, ensuring that both parties are prepared for the discussion. Preferred communication channels are often email for initial contacts, with phone calls being more common for follow-up or urgent matters.

Taiwan Phone Numbers: What to Expect

Taiwan's mobile numbers are distinctive: they run nine digits domestically and nearly all begin with 09 — 0912, 0916, 0935 and dozens of similar combinations assigned across Chunghwa Telecom, Taiwan Mobile, FarEasTone, and their subsidiaries. Geographic landlines carry shorter area codes: Taipei is 02, Taichung is 04, Kaohsiung is 07, Tainan is 06. Calling a landline in Taipei means the local portion is eight digits; outside Taipei, local numbers can be seven or eight digits depending on the district. The more relevant distinction is behavioral: landlines at home are answered by whoever is there, while mobiles are personal and Taiwanese users are fairly reliable about answering recognized numbers. LINE is woven so deeply into daily communication — used for everything from family group chats to restaurant orders — that a LINE call or message often reaches people faster than a voice call to a mobile.

Beating Carrier Rates in Cairo

Egypt's mobile market is price-sensitive at every level. Egyptian pound depreciation has made foreign-currency calling costs feel sharper in real terms: even a modest IDD rate in dollars or euros translates to a meaningful sum when converted. Orange Egypt and Vodafone Egypt offer international calling add-ons, but the rates for European mobile numbers — Italy, France, Germany — tend to be noticeably higher than rates for Gulf landlines. A Cairo parent calling a daughter on an Italian mobile number faces that gap every time. App-based calls routed over Egypt's expanding 4G and 5G networks, or over home broadband in the city's better-served districts, flatten those destination premiums. The call to Milan costs the same per minute as the call to Riyadh, which is how it should work when the underlying data network doesn't know or care where the voice is going.

Cost-Saving Habits for Calling Taiwan

Taiwan Standard Time is UTC+8, fixed year-round with no daylight saving. That makes scheduling arithmetic stable — from the US West Coast, Taiwan is fifteen or sixteen hours ahead depending on US clock changes. Business hours run roughly 9 AM to 6 PM on weekdays, with a genuine lunch break around noon to 1 PM when calls often go unanswered. Landlines to Taipei and other cities are generally cheaper per minute than Taiwanese mobiles, and many offices still use them as primary contact numbers. The stretches to plan around: Lunar New Year (typically late January or early February) shuts down most businesses for at least a week and often longer, and personal contacts are hard to reach across the full holiday window. National Day on October 10 is a single-day closure. Outside those periods, Taiwan is one of the more reliably reachable places in East Asia — calls tend to get answered or returned promptly.
